Load resistance keeps the abrasive particles exposed to maintain a consistent cut rate. Our general purpose pad can be cut and used by hand for precise control. Wider width stock can be cut and paired with a hand pad holder for uniform finishing, or on an inline or oscillating sander to cover larger areas.
We manufacture Scotch-Brite Clean and Finish Rolls with a choice of silicon carbide, aluminum oxide, or talc abrasive mineral. Silicon carbide is a synthetic mineral that is very sharp and commonly used for low-pressure applications such as paint prep and finishing. Aluminum oxide is a hard, blocky mineral that provides high cut-rate and long life. While silicon carbide breaks down faster than aluminum oxide, it produces a finer finish. Talc is a mild abrasive that can be used achieve a satin finish or with polish to create a high gloss finish in topcoat rubbing applications.
Our Scotch-Brite abrasives are unique surface conditioning products with abrasives incorporated into non-woven fiber matrix. Combining abrasives and non-woven material creates an abrasive system that delivers consistent results for the life of the product. The open-web material runs cool and is load resistant, which keeps the abrasive minerals cutting at high performance by limiting clogging of the fibers.
